At Bures Train Station, ticketing is made simple with readily available ticket machines. You can collect tickets purchased online or buy them directly from the machine. Although there isn't a staffed ticket office, assistance is offered through customer help points where helpful staff are on hand to provide information and support. The station ensures accessibility with features like induction loops and smartcard validators, catering to a wide range of passenger needs.
While the station lacks some amenities like restrooms, a waiting room, and refreshment facilities, it makes up for it with a cozy seating area, and CCTV ensures safety around the clock. The platform offers partial step-free access, ideal for travelers with some mobility concerns, though a companion might be advisable for those needing additional support.
For those continuing their journey by road, the station forecourt accommodates rail replacement services for a seamless transit experience. Although there's no direct bus service or taxi rank, the surrounding area is well-served by local transport providers willing to pick up and drop off travelers from nearby locations.

The station is well-equipped for both seasoned rail travelers and occasional passengers. Ticketing is seamless here, with a ticket office open from early morning until late into the evening. Ticket machines are available for those in a rush or purchasing online, and they cater to those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. The station is designed for accessibility, with step-free access across all platforms, making it easier for everyone, including those with mobility issues.
Travelers can find help at the customer assistance points and make use of the convenient departure screens and announcements for real-time information. While there is no luggage storage available, CCTV cameras ensure security throughout the premises. Though the station lacks a dedicated waiting room, it does offer seating areas and accessible toilets to make your wait more comfortable.
If you're in the mood for a coffee or a snack, you'll be pleased to know that refreshment facilities are available, along with shops and an ATM located at the entrance.
Travelling onward from St Albans City is a breeze with its extensive transport links. The station supports a robust rail replacement service ensuring minimal disruption to your travel plans. There's a dedicated taxi service for those needing a direct ride to their destination. Buses are also readily available to tunnel you across St Albans and surrounding areas.
